My Friend dropped off the incubator. It was in terrible shape! I cleaned it as best I could but it smelled electrical when plugged in. I have a diff home made incubator. I will start the eggs in that, then move the eggs to the hen on Sun.
Here are the eggs in incubator...one more dark egg had a crack and was removed. I did add another Wyandotte tan egg- I was not going to set it because it was porous. But I thought I would any way. The hen will not get the porous egg. I will keep it in incubator.
1x.PNG
 
Hen has 11 eggs I kept the tan eggs and the green egg to the right in incubator, so hen will not have such a big job. My friend will drop off 6 eggs in a few days, they will go into incubator, and eventually after the nest batch hatches, the incubator eggs will move under hen again. She loves it!
 
the 2 tan wyandotte eggs and one BCM was empty. I removed them, I am not giving up on the other BCM egg yet it is so dark...The green blue Isbar eggs are going strong, and the other BCM eggs under the hen are fine. day 4.

4 looked how I would expect, the others had a saddle shape but I still saw veins so I let her keep them. I expected 11 and she only had 10 unless she was hiding one. One of the green eggs had a bad crack at the tip. (looked like a dent) some leakage. The development look okay though. I took the egg and put it in a plastic bag that was open at the air cell side and put the leaking pointy end in the bag, with the leaky side up so it would not leak more. Then put it in incubator by itself, with a nice water dish.

day 17 I went to check hen's nest, and one brown egg also had a dent, nothing spilling out, the dent was by the air cell, i put the egg with the green egg in incubator, green egg is out of the bag, the dent with ooze on green egg, sealed it's self. both eggs still have veins. the 2 dented eggs are in my incubator, the other 8 are with the hen.
 
Day 19 and the green egg is gone, the brown egg with small dent, smelled fine, and still had veins, so I put it back with mom hen that has 9 total. since tomorrow is day 20 and all eggs will be hatching, hopefully. I did see them in the air cells on day 19.
